Well, I learned the hard way that if you want to add an 2000W inverter, you’ll need 200ah of LiFePO4. A 100ah lithium will work just fine with 300-400W of solar. But adding an inverter changes that equation.

The available space on my 21’ Travel trailer’s roof limited me to three 100 W panels. However, Rich Solar now offers a “slim” 100W panel. The panel’s dimensions: 58.7 x 13.8 x 1.2 in fits nicely on the very front of the 8’ wide roof. It would sit 2-3” from the leading edge of the trailer.
